Abstract
Spermatozoa were collected from the rat caput epididymidis by micropuncture and their motility was assessed after dilution in physiological saline containing carnitine or related compounds. L(+)-Carnitine caused, 2 min after dilution, a transient stimulation of the motility of spermatozoa with low initial motility. No stimulatory effects were seen on spermatozoa which had high initial motility. The D-isomer inhibited the motility of spermatozoa with high initial motility after 2 min and all compounds tested appeared to inhibit, at 20 min after dilution, the motility of spermatozoa with high initial motility. Acetyl-L-carnitine and acetyl-D-carnitine stimulated the motility of spermatozoa with low initial motility. Carnitine may be important in development by spermatozoa of the potential for motility and in maintenance of mature spermatozoa in a quiescent state.This publication has 10 references indexed in Scilit:
